The Gwangju Museum of Art has been organizing annual exhibitions in overseas cities since 2012, to introduce the works of artists based in Gwangju and Jeollanam-do to an international audience and provide opportunities for broad, mutual exchange. This year, in collaboration with the Sakima Art Museum in Okinawa, eight artists from Gwangju and Jeonnam will join forces with six artists from Okinawa to present an exhibition titled "Interwoven Narratives" with the theme of "history and peace."
